The problems generated by the Java language usage of data-parallel programs using the SPMD model of parallel execution is discussed in the paper. The sequential components of a parallel program are executed in parallel on distinct JavaVMs running on processors of the parallel computer. Links between the parallel program components are carried out by means of the standard message passing interface package MPI. A parallel extension of Java is made by means of Java itself, namely by DPJ class library, containing the set, of Java classes and interfaces. The description of the DPJ library is a main subject of this paper. The scope of the paper is restricted to the implementation of the DPJ library for a set of JavaVM.
Keywords for this software
References in zbMATH (referenced in 3 articles , 1 standard article )
Showing results 1 to 3 of 3.
- Paul, Christopher; Mason, William M.; Mccaffrey, Daniel; Fox, Sarah A.: A cautionary case study of approaches to the treatment of missing data (2008)
- Shortle, John F.; Brill, Percy H.: Analytical distribution of waiting time in the M/\iD1 queue (2005)
- Ivannikov, V.; Gaissaryan, S.; Dommrachev, M.; Etch, V.; Shtaltovnaya, N.: DPJ: Java class library for development of data-parallel programs (1997)